3- Phenyl isothiazolium salts

Methyl-3-phenyl-isothiazolium salts 27a,b were attacked at the N-atom with the /V,A-binucleophile 2-aminoethanthiol to obtain thioethylaminothiones 290a,b in 48-57% yield (72JCS(P1)2305, Scheme 96). [Pg.276]

Accordingly, iV-phenyl-substituted isothiazolium salts bearing a benzo crown ether substituent were employed in this synthetic protocol and led to the synthesis of various crown ether-substituted 6aA4-thia-l,6-diazapentalenes 201... [Pg.520]

The synthesis of novel substituted 6aA4-thia-l,6-diazapentalenes 33 was achieved by a base-induced dimerization of two isothiazolium salts <2001PS(170)29>. It was shown that A -phenyl-substituted isothiazolium salts having active 5-methyl or 5-methylene groups can easily be obtained by reaction of (l-thiocyanatovinylaldehydes and substituted anilines <1995CZ175>. [Pg.686]

Accordance to other named isothiazolium salts 57 (R = H), offered the inspection of the X-ray data of 3,4-dimethyl-2-phenylisothiazolium perchlorate 68a, received after an isomerization of 4,5-dimethyl-2-phenylisothiazolium perchlorate in ethanol, the typical salt structure with S-N bond of 1.682 A and 2-phenyl ring is 86.9° out of plane of the isothiazole ring (98JPR361). [Pg.260]

Especially, 2-phenyl-4,5,6,7-tetrahydro-l,2-benz- (121) and 5-methyl-2,4-diphenyl-isothiazolium salts 62 (R = H, 4-MeO, 2-C1, 2,6-Cl2) were studied with the HPLC-MS(MS) method to monitor the oxidation of isothiazolium salts with H202/acetic acid (96%) (03CG147). The strongly acidic reaction mixture was separated on a RP-18 column without any sample pretreatment and included intermediates, which were identified by API-MS(MS)-techniques. The aim of this work was to establish the reaction mechanism using several N-functionalized salts. [Pg.265]
